Commissioners award $2.45 million contract for Lyons water tower project

Fulton County commissioners accepted the engineer’s recommendation and awarded the Lyons water tower construction contract to Maguire Iron, Inc. for $2,454,000; the vote was unanimous 3-0 and a contract will be issued.

The Fulton County Board of Commissioners voted Jan. 27, 2026, to award the Lyons Water Tower Project to Maguire Iron, Inc. for $2,454,000 after receiving a recommendation from Verdantas LLC, the county engineer. The award was adopted as Resolution 2026-075 and passed 3-0.

Bids for the project were received Jan. 16, 2026; the board’s resolution records the engineer’s recommendation that Maguire Iron, Inc. submitted the lowest and best unit-price bid and that a contract shall be issued. The action clears the way for contract execution and subsequent project scheduling and permitting steps overseen by the county engineer.

The board took the vote during its regular session at the commissioners’ meeting room in Wauseon; the motion passed unanimously with Commissioners Joe Short, Jon Rupp and Jeff Rupp recorded as voting yes. The resolution directs issuance of a contract; the meeting record does not specify a contractor start date or construction timeline.
